Title: How to Safeguard Your Agricultural Machinery

Agriculture, as the backbone of many economies, demands an immense amount of dedication, labor, and crucially, machinery. These machines, often representing a considerable investment for farmers, are indispensable for a farm’s daily operations, from tilling and sowing to harvesting and post-harvest processes. Their longevity and efficiency directly impact productivity, profitability, and sustainability. However, the challenges of maintaining these intricate machines are vast, from battling natural elements, preventing wear and tear, to safeguarding them from theft. In the vast expanse of a farm, ensuring each piece of machinery is protected can be daunting. This guide aims to simplify this process, providing strategies and best practices to ensure that your agricultural tools remain in optimal condition for years to come.
